Ingredients:
1/4 cup onion, chopped
1/4 large ripe tomato, peeled, seeded, and chopp
1/4 cup habanero, seeded and chopped
1/4 cup seville (bitter) orange juice *
1 salt to taste
Instructions:
* or substitute a mixture of 1 part orange juice to 2 parts fresh lime
juice.
In a bowl combine all the ingredients, seasoning with salt. Serve
whenever a chilli sauce is called for.
Andrews says this Ixni-Pec is pronounced schnee-pec. This dish is
from Yucatan, in Mexico.
From Elisabeth Lambert Ortiz, in Jean Andrew's _Red Hot Peppers_
MacMillan, 1993 ISBN 0-02-502251-2. Typos by Jeff Pruett.
